Когда дело доходит до эффективного редактирования кода и манипулирования текстом в Android Studio, освоение различных методов выделения может значительно повысить вашу продуктивность. В этой статье мы рассмотрим семь удобных методов выполнения вертикального выбора в Android Studio, специально разработанных для пользователей Mac. Итак, хватайте клавиатуру и будьте готовы повысить уровень своей игры в программирование!
- Использование техники Shift + Option + перетаскивание.
Один из самых простых способов выполнить вертикальное выделение в Android Studio на Mac — использование техники Shift + Option + перетаскивание. Нажмите и удерживайте клавиши Shift и Option одновременно, а затем щелкните и перетащите указатель мыши, чтобы создать вертикальное выделение. Этот метод позволяет быстро выбирать столбцы текста и одновременно вносить изменения.
Пример:
Предположим, у вас есть блок кода, в котором вы хотите вертикально выделить и изменить определенные строки. Используя технику Shift + Option + перетаскивание, вы можете легко выделить конкретный столбец и сразу внести необходимые изменения.
- Использование режима выбора столбца.
Android Studio предоставляет встроенный режим выбора столбца, который позволяет легко выполнять вертикальный выбор. Чтобы активировать этот режим, нажмите и удерживайте клавишу Option на клавиатуре Mac и щелкните нужную начальную точку выбора. Затем перейдите к конечной точке выделения с помощью клавиш со стрелками, удерживая клавишу Option. Этот метод позволяет точно выбирать столбцы для быстрого редактирования.
Пример:
Предположим, в вашем коде есть табличная структура, в которой вы хотите выбрать определенный столбец для изменения значений. Включив режим выбора столбца и используя клавиши со стрелками, вы сможете легко выбрать нужный столбец и внести необходимые изменения.
- Использование поиска и замены с помощью регулярных выражений (RegEx).
Еще один мощный метод вертикального выбора в Android Studio на Mac включает использование функций поиска и замены с помощью регулярных выражений (RegEx). Создав подходящий шаблон RegEx, вы можете выбирать и изменять текст по вертикали на основе определенных критериев.
Пример:
Предположим, у вас есть список переменных в вашем коде, и вы хотите добавить префикс к каждому имени переменной. Создав шаблон RegEx, соответствующий именам переменных, вы можете выбрать нужный столбец и выполнить операцию поиска и замены для эффективного добавления префикса.
<ол старт="4">
Редактирование с несколькими курсорами — это замечательная функция в Android Studio, которая позволяет создавать несколько курсоров или курсоров для одновременного редактирования. Чтобы выполнить вертикальное выделение этим методом, нажмите и удерживайте клавишу Option на клавиатуре Mac и щелкайте в разных точках нужного столбца. Создав несколько курсоров, вы можете вводить или удалять текст одновременно, что упрощает быстрое редактирование.
Пример:
Предположим, у вас есть список вызовов методов в вашем коде, и вы хотите добавить параметр к каждому вызову. Используя редактирование нескольких кареток, вы можете создать несколько кареток в конце каждой строки, ввести новый параметр один раз, и он будет добавлен ко всем строкам одновременно.
- Использование прямоугольного выделения.
Прямоугольное выделение — отличный метод вертикального выделения в Android Studio на Mac. Чтобы активировать этот режим, нажмите и удерживайте клавишу Command на клавиатуре Mac, затем щелкните и перетащите, чтобы создать прямоугольное выделение. Этот метод позволяет вам выбрать определенный столбец по вертикали, даже если строки имеют разную длину.
Пример:
Предположим, у вас есть блок кода, в котором вы хотите выбрать определенный столбец, охватывающий строки разной длины. Используя прямоугольное выделение, вы можете создать прямоугольную область и выполнять редактирование только внутри этой выбранной области.
- Использование инструмента «Найти и заменить».
Инструмент «Найти и заменить» в Android Studio не ограничивается поиском и заменой определенных текстовых шаблонов. Его также можно использовать для вертикального выбора. Используя уникальный разделитель или маркер в своем коде, вы можете искать этот шаблон, выбирать нужный столбец и эффективно вносить изменения.
Пример:
Предположим, у вас есть блок кода с комментариями, который вы хотите выделить и удалить по вертикали. Вставив уникальный маркер или разделитель перед каждым комментарием, вы можете использовать инструмент «Найти и заменить», чтобы выбрать нужный столбец и удалить все комментарии одновременно.
- Создание пользовательских макросов или плагинов.
Для опытных пользователей создание пользовательских макросов или плагинов в Android Studio может обеспечить беспрецедентную гибкость вертикального выбора. Определив собственные команды или сочетания клавиш, вы можете автоматизировать процесс вертикального выделения и с легкостью выполнять сложные изменения.
Пример:
Предположим, вы часто работаете с определенным форматом файла, который требует вертикального выбора и манипуляций. Создав собственный макрос или плагин, понимающий структуру файла, вы можете упростить процесс вертикального выбора и сэкономить драгоценное время.
Освоение методов вертикального выделения в Android Studio на Mac может значительно повысить эффективность кодирования. Используя технику Shift + Option + Drag, режим выбора столбца, поиск по регулярным выражениям, редактирование с несколькими курсорами, прямоугольное выделение, инструмент «Найти и заменить», а также пользовательские макросы или плагины, вы можете выполнять точные изменения в определенных столбцах кода и повышать свою производительность.. Поэкспериментируйте с этими методами, найдите те, которые лучше всего подходят для вашего рабочего процесса, и наблюдайте за стремительным ростом скорости кодирования. Приятного кодирования!